My Gruppe-S Experience (8/5/2006)

Driving along Skyline a few weeks ago I went through a massive pothole (the holes on that road are insane in places), my 18" rims and dropped springs have a pretty harsh ride, and it turned out that I bent my suspension control arm and broke my Helix endlink....I've had those endlinks for nearly a year and have been to the track with them 3 times so I figured I'd need to buy a new set.

Gruppe-S supply and fit everything on my car, so I took it this morning for them to take a look at since it was making all kinds of clunking and banging noises and they confirmed I needed a new set of endlinks. They fitted them in less than 30 minutes (that Tommy guy can really wrench), and when I asked how much I owed them for the new endlinks Mike said "nothing, they're covered under warranty".

So even though I regularly track my car, and even though it was a combination of a huge pot-hole and my driving that broke the endlink, they were replaced free of charge with no questions asked.

That's what I like about this shop....they do good work and stand by their work and by their products.

Being as I take my car to different racetracks, I assumed that my warranty would be voided, I bang up and down those kerbs and try and use the whole width of the track... It says a lot for Helix parts that they still replaced them under warranty.

Theres a lot of more expensive parts out there than Helix, but Gruppe-S runs 3 race cars and their Helix parts get a thorough testing and have earned themselves a great reputation...same with Rota wheels....they can get beaten on week after week and still stand up to the punishment....

With the high quality of low cost parts like Helix and Rota it's making it affordable for me to run an everyday commuter car that will take a good track beating every month or so.
